{"id":"68adbeab-2460-4dfe-9fb0-baaf716d66aa","task":"File an ISF 10+2 Importer Security Filing on time with US CBP","domain":"cbp.gov","steps":["Gather the 10 data elements required from the importer: seller, buyer, importer of record number, consignee number, manufacturer, ship-to party, country of origin, commodity HTSUS, container stuffing location, and consolidator.","Submit the ISF to CBP via an ACE-certified filing agent or your own ACE portal account **no later than 24 hours before cargo is laden (loaded) aboard the vessel** at the foreign port of export.","File the 2 carrier data elements (vessel stow plan and container status messages) separately through the ocean carrier or their agent.","After filing, monitor CBP's `ISF_ACCEPTED` and `ISF_MATCHED` messages in ACE; resolve any mismatch or rejection notices before the vessel arrives.","Update the ISF if any data elements change after submission — updates are required as soon as discrepancies are known and no later than 24 hours before US arrival."],"gotchas":["The ISF deadline is **24 hours before cargo is laden aboard the vessel** at the foreign port — not 24 hours before vessel departure or arrival; by vessel departure the window has already closed.","Late, inaccurate, or incomplete filings each carry a liquidated damages penalty of up to **$5,000 per violation** from CBP.","The ISF is not required for cargo traveling by air, rail, or truck — it applies only to ocean shipments arriving in the United States."],"contributor":"waymark-seed","created":"2026-06-12T12:28:18.114Z","attestations":{"success":0,"failure":0,"keyed_success":0,"keyed_failure":0,"last_attested":null},"success_rate":null,"effective_trust":0.5,"evidence_age_days":null,"trust_half_life_days":60,"verification":{"status":"sampled","method":"legacy-file-sample","at":"2026-06-13T18:43:44.792Z"},"url":"https://mcp.waymark.network/r/68adbeab-2460-4dfe-9fb0-baaf716d66aa"}
